After 12th it was hard trying to choose from a list of colleges. I made up my mind to choose Mechanical during my higher secondary studies. Since I had a low KEAM score private colleges were the only options left for me. So I looked for colleges matching my interests. Finally, I had two options left it was Saintgits and SJCET. SJCET had NBA accreditation for the mechanical branch and it was very near to Palai town which was appealing to me. So I went to the college to get more details. The college had such a nice infrastructure, the building was nice and the campus was beautiful and neat. The staffs were helpful, so I decided to go forward with the admission. KEAM was necessary to get an easy admission there. There wasn't any interview or anything. I didn't get any scholarships since I didn't match the criteria so I had to pay full fees. A fitness certificate must be submitted to the college while joining.
Course Curriculum Overview
The college mainly focuses on academics so the studies were very organized. Many of the faculty members from the Mechanical branch were PhD holders and experienced lectures. The college held 2 internal exams for internal assessments. The exam difficulty level varies. The branch had a sufficient amount of faculty members. Mentors were assigned to students to evaluate their studies, a group of 10 students each had a mentor.

Placement Experience
The college offers good placements. A number of reputed companies including Infosys, TCS, Experion Technologies, UST global, cognizant, Quest etc conduct placement activities. More than 55 companies visit on average and the salary package is 3 lakh per annum on average. Placement training will be given from 1st year onwards and a much more important training will be given during 4th year. Placements will be held during semester 7. A student must have a 60% score and no backlogs to attend the placement. Fees and Financial Aid
The general fees structure is 37,500 per semester. There were many scholarships for students. If you have an 80% above mark for PCM in HSE or a 75% mark in PCM in CBSE or if you have ranked in KEAM between 20,001 and 25,000 you are eligible for scholarship category 4 which means your course fees now will be 32,500. Then for category 3 you need 85% for PCM in HSE or 80% for PCM in CBSE or rank in KEAM between 15,001 and 20,000 now your course fee will be 27,500. If you have 90% for PCM in HSE or 85% for PCM in CBSE or rank between 10,001 and 15,000 you are eligible for category 2 by which your new fees will be 17,500. If you have 95% for PCM in HSE and 85% for PCM in CBSE or a rank below 10,001 then you are eligible for category 1 which the fees will be only 8,200 per year. The fees structure include course fee + value-added course fee (5000) + PTA fund (once a year) + University exam fees.
Campus Life
The college gives more importance to academics so the social life is pretty much dull. The college had auto shows and department fest fee years back but the decision to stop all that. Now the college offers a Technical fest and an arts fest each year. A sports day is held each year which have almost no importance whatsoever. The college departments offer technical groups such as ASME, SAE, IEEE etc. The Bootcamp is pretty much active and it offers good events once in a while. The college has a music club and a Jesus youth program. The library is one of the best you can get, and it is one of the greatest positive of the college. The library holds a Total Collection of 61,249 (as of March 2021). It includes an ebook section of almost 6,500. The classrooms are good and well ventilated. The college also has 2 NSS units and 1 NCC unit.
